In its twenty-five years of serving the community of Charleston, the South Carolina Aquarium has fought for the education and preservation of the animals, oceans and landscapes of South Carolina. Through many conservation efforts, research teams and even a hospital dedicated to rehabilitation of sea turtles, the aquarium has exceeded expectations.

To fulfill the purpose of bringing in new funding and awareness for all the South Carolina Aquarium has to offer, a twenty-five year anniversary rebrand was created. Utilizing new logos, imagery and touch points that celebrate the past and future of the aquarium breathes new passion and life back into the community that the SCA has poured itself into tenfold.

By having three campaign logos, each could highlight an aspect of the aquarium to highlight and help support. This branding overall needed to feel exciting, passionate and energetic to drawn in a new and returning customers alike.

  • A Primary “25” lockup emulating the waves of the Charleston harbor

  • A Sea Turtle with a “25” as its iconic pattern to highlight the aquarium’s resident loggerhead sea turtle, Caretta

  • A combination of the primary “25” and a sea turtle head specifically to highlight the sea turtle hospital and its efforts
